  Original Title: Authoritative Interview|Let Robots “+” Out of China’s New World of Manufacturing-Interpretation of the “Fourteenth Five-Year” Robot Industry Development Plan by the heads of relevant departments and bureaus of the Ministry of Industry and Information Technology

The “Fourteenth Five-Year” Robot Industry Development Plan issued by the Ministry of Industry and Information Technology, the National Development and Reform Commission, the Ministry of Science and Technology and other departments and units recently proposed that by 2025, my country will become a global robot technology innovation center, high-end manufacturing cluster and integrated application center. High ground.

How to make breakthroughs in a batch of core robot technologies and high-end products, and how to make robots lead the intelligent development? The reporter interviewed the heads of relevant departments and bureaus of the Ministry of Industry and Information Technology a few days ago to respond to hot issues in the robotics industry.

 “Two steps” to promote the high-quality development of the robotics industry

The research, development, manufacturing, and application of robots are important indicators to measure the level of technological innovation and high-end manufacturing in a country.

During the “Thirteenth Five-Year Plan” period, the scale of my country’s robotics industry has grown rapidly. In 2020, its operating income will exceed 100 billion yuan, and the density of manufacturing robots will be nearly twice the global average. At present, the new generation of information technology, biotechnology, etc. are deeply integrated with robotics, and the robotics industry is ushering in a window period for upgrading and leaping development. It is crucial to accelerate breakthroughs in weak links and promote the industry to move toward the high-end.

Wang Weiming, Director of the Equipment Industry Department I of the Ministry of Industry and Information Technology, said that the plan is based on the high-quality development of the robotics industry, and from the perspectives of technology, scale, application, ecology, etc., the development goals of the “14th Five-Year Plan” and even longer are proposed in “two steps”. .

“Achieving development goals cannot be accomplished overnight. We are’two-way effort’ from both sides of supply and demand.” Wang Weiming said that the plan is to consolidate the industrial foundation, strengthen the key core technology of robots, and supplement special materials, core components, and processing techniques. Other shortcomings; focus on enhancing product supply, facing the needs of key industries, gathering superior resources, promoting the development of high-end robot products, expanding robot product series and types; focusing on expanding market applications, promoting the development of typical robot application scenarios, and optimizing the industrial ecology.

In order to ensure the implementation of various tasks, four actions including “Robot Core Technology Research Action”, “Robot Key Foundation Improvement Action”, “Robot Innovation Product Development Action”, and “‘Robot +’Application Action” have been planned and deployed.

Wang Weiming said that the plan will focus on improving the innovation capabilities of the robotics industry, speed up the resolution of problems such as insufficient technology accumulation, weak industrial foundations, and lack of high-end supplies, and promote the high-quality development of the robotics industry.

  Problem-oriented, focus on weak links and precise support

“During the ’13th Five-Year Plan’ period, in order to consolidate the foundation for the development of the robotics industry, we have carried out a series of work in three aspects: making up for shortcomings, establishing standards, and improving inspection capabilities.” Wang Weiming said, precision reducers, high-performance servo drive systems, etc. The technological level and industrialization capabilities continue to improve, but in terms of the supply of high-end parts and components, it has not yet been able to meet the needs of the rapidly developing industry.

He said that in order to accelerate the improvement of the basic capabilities of the robotics industry, the plan is to make relevant deployments from three aspects. One is to make up for shortcomings in industrial development. Focus on supplementing the shortcomings of special materials, core components, and processing techniques. The second is to strengthen the construction of the standard system. The third is to improve testing and certification capabilities, and improve quality and reliability.

Cultivating and expanding high-quality enterprises is also an important measure to strengthen the chain. According to the data from Tianyan Check, there are more than 339,000 robot-related companies in my country. In the past five years, the registration growth rate of new robot-related companies has increased.

The plan is clear, and strive to form a group of internationally competitive leading companies and a large number of innovative, high-growth, specialized and new “little giant” companies by 2025, and build 3 to 5 industries with international influence Cluster.

Wang Hong, deputy director of the Equipment Industry Department I of the Ministry of Industry and Information Technology, said that a group of specialized and special new “little giant” enterprises will be built in the areas of complete robots, parts and system integration, and key enterprises will be encouraged to join supporting enterprises to speed up precision gears and lubrication. Research and development, engineering verification and iterative upgrades of grease and encoders.

  Focus on the market and implement the “Robot +” application action

The plan is clear, the implementation of the “robot +” application action, and the promotion of the development of typical application scenarios for robots.

Wang Hong said that during the “14th Five-Year Plan” period, it will face the needs of industrial transformation and consumption upgrades, deepen industry applications, expand emerging applications, and strengthen characteristic applications.

The Ministry of Industry and Information Technology has made it clear that in areas where large-scale applications have been formed, such as automobiles, electronics, machinery, etc., it will focus on the development and promotion of new robot products, and further promote intelligent manufacturing and intelligent life. In areas where initial applications and potential demand are relatively strong, such as mining, agriculture, power, etc., pilot demonstrations will be carried out in combination with specific scenarios. In specific sub-scenarios, links and fields, professional and customized solutions are formed and replicated and promoted.

It is worth mentioning that in terms of industrial robots, the focus is on the development of high-precision and high-reliability welding robots for the automotive, aerospace and other fields, vacuum (clean) robots for the semiconductor industry, and collaborative robots for auto parts and other fields. . In terms of service robots, the focus is on the development of agricultural robots such as orchard weeding, precision plant protection, picking and harvesting, mining robots such as mining and inspection, medical rehabilitation robots such as surgery and nursing, and public service robots including guidance and distribution.

“We will promote the integration and application of new technologies such as artificial intelligence, 5G, and big data, and improve the level of robot intelligence and networking.” Wang Hong said. (Reporter Zhang Xinxin)
